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41926265 53 65278556 90586696 8849813595
05688 572711 8608
05688 572711 8608
983408 82787 807 5395261
All about undefined
Interested in learning more?
05688 572711 8608
983408 82787 807 5395261
See more
5370889 35118930015
378 465657 496007489
See more
7189 83548609681 9527671
423 3536555 173 891899 444840
See more